Illicit Cigarettes Hit 45% UK Market, Cost £4.5bn

Story summary
  • Illicit consumption rose to 45% of United Kingdom use in 2025, adding 1.5 billion cigarettes versus 2024.
  • Over 10 billion illicit cigarettes were smoked in 2025, costing more than £4.46 billion in lost tax revenue.
  • Front shops posing as grocers, vape or candy stores and United Kingdom factories drive the illicit market.
  • Philip Morris Limited urged a licensing scheme and undercover teams, warning that weak enforcement costs the United Kingdom £4.5 billion a year.
